The T&Cs seem to say thy are a United Arab Emirates company. Although another section says they are registered in Sofia, Bulgaria.
The main issue people have with third party agents is if something with the booking changes. If you book with an agent you cannot deal directly with the airline, you will need to go via your agent. That’s when people can run into problems. Booking tickets is largely automated so that’s usually no issue - it’s when you need some human interaction the problems can start!
How much cheaper than going directly to the airline, or using a reputable well known agent are they?0 -
